Tag: psycopg2

如何捕获重复?

我是相对较新的Python,我正在导入Excel到PostgreSQL。 Excel中的地址列有我想要的重复项。 什么是最可行的方法去。 import psycopg2 import xlrd book = xlrd.open_workbook("data.xlsx") sheet = book.sheet_by_name("List") database = psycopg2.connect (database = "Excel", user="SQL", password="PASS", host="YES", port="DB") cursor = database.cursor() delete = """Drop table if exists "Python".list""" print (delete) mydata = cursor.execute(delete) cursor.execute('''CREATE TABLE "Python".list (DCAD_Prop_ID varchar(50), Address varchar(50), Addition varchar(50), Block varchar(50), Lot integer, Project_ID integer );''') print […]